Will Sofyan Amrabat stay at Man Utd?

At this point, Sofyan Amrabat refrains from making any predictions about the potential permanency of his loan arrangement with Manchester United. After an extensive pursuit throughout the summer, the Red Devils ultimately secured a season-long loan deal with Fiorentina towards the end of the transfer window, securing Amrabat’s presence at Old Trafford for the remainder of the 2023-24 season. Amrabat has quickly won over the hearts of the Red Devils’ fan base, making an impressive full debut against Crystal Palace in the Carabao Cup. When questioned about his future plans after the match, he responded, ‘I don’t dwell on that. At this moment, I’m a Manchester United player. All I can do is give my all every day, do my utmost to assist the team, and hope for a fantastic season with potential silverware. As for what happens later, we’ll see. Of course, I’d love to stay here, but that’s not my primary concern. I don’t look too far ahead.’

While Amrabat attracted interest from other clubs, including Liverpool, he maintains that Manchester was always his preferred destination. When asked about the challenges he faced during a summer filled with uncertainty, the 27-year-old remarked, ‘Yes, certainly. It all began after the club’s last game, the Conference League final against West Ham. From that point on, the transfer window opened for me. There were numerous clubs, a lot of discussions, but for me, the choice was clear: I wanted to join Manchester United. It was a long and difficult few months, but in the end, signing here on the last day is what matters most now.’
